Houlton Maine International Airport ? Noooo...You Don't Fly In On Jumbo Jets.
    
Years ago before deregulation in the airline industry, planes from Northeast and other lines catered to and service little towns like Houlton Maine.  The government helped support the airline to these smaller off the beaten path areas. But from a practical standpoint, you do not have 757, air buses or L 1011's full of passengers coming into Houlton Maine eight times a day. 
That is why it is a great place to live, not tons of people. All that traffic. On the ground, in the sky.
The folks, ones we have are friendly, caring and helpful! During World War Two the airport in Houlton Maine was very much a part of the war effort.
(See earlier blog post  http://activerain.com/blogsview/67360/Houlton-Maine-farmer-helps ) about area farmers hauling war planes with chains into New Brunswick Canada.
Rolling them, tail dragging them  across the border.
To help in the War II effort from Houlton International Airport as the front end of the supply.
Even if there are not hourly runs of planes in and out like some airports schedule day and night.
You can bring your private plane, corporate jet in easily to Houlton International Airport.
You can charter flights too.
